Output ec3fc58990cbf090ff403696a9dca483201cfcb240bbec02413714120670062d:6

value
50000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 98b0076fd75305a6ad206f4ab9cdde05447e5964d33846ddd79b7b93646def66
address
bc1pnzcqwm7h2vz6dtfqda9tnnw7q4z8ukty6vuydhwhndaexerdaanqav87wk
transaction
ec3fc58990cbf090ff403696a9dca483201cfcb240bbec02413714120670062d
spent
true